Stargazing Essentials

  • Telescope: Invest in a quality telescope to observe distant stars and planets up close.
  • Stellar Map: A star chart or mobile app can help you navigate the night sky and identify celestial objects.
  • Camera: Capture stunning images of the cosmos with a DSLR camera or a smartphone equipped for astrophotography.
  • Warm Clothing: Dress in layers to stay comfortable during late-night stargazing sessions.

Must-Visit Celestial Sites

Discover breathtaking celestial sights that will leave you in awe:

  1. The Milky Way: Our home galaxy offers a spectacular display of stars, nebulae, and dust clouds.
  2. Orion Nebula: Located in the Orion constellation, this stellar nursery is a favorite among stargazers.
  3. Andromeda Galaxy: The closest spiral galaxy to the Milky Way, visible to the naked eye under dark skies.

Capturing the Cosmos

Photographing the night sky requires patience and practice. Follow these tips to capture stunning cosmic images:

  1. Use a tripod to keep your camera stable and prevent blurry photos.
  2. Experiment with different exposure times to capture the beauty of star trails or deep-sky objects.
  3. Consider using a remote shutter release to minimize camera shake.
